Group A will play all their games in Copenhagen:
Russia
Sweden
Czech Republic
Switzerland
Belarus
Slovakia
France
Austria

Group B will play all their games in Herning:
Canada
USA
Finland
Germany
Norway
Latvia
Denmark
Korea

The quarterfinals will be split between Herning and Copenhagen (each city gets 2 games). While the semifinals, bronze, and gold medal games will be in Copenhagen.
